記事No | : 8080 |
投稿日 | : 2010/10/28(Thu) 17:08:03 |
タイトル | : WEB MART 送料を地域別、金額別で無料にするには? |
ID情報 | : 3758 |
投稿者 | : 73 |
URL | : http://benifu-ki.com |
以前よりカート便利に使用させて頂いております。
送料について以下のような場合どのように変更したらよいのでしょうか。
お買上金額が
5,250円以上送料無料(その他の地域)
北海道10,500円以上送料無料
沖縄21,000円以上送料無料
それ未満の時は、地域送料が計上されるというものです
可能であればご教授頂けますようお願い致します。
記事No | : 8081 |
投稿日 | : 2010/10/28(Thu) 20:41:48 |
タイトル | : Re: WEB MART 送料を地域別、金額別で無料にするには? |
ID情報 | : Fuyuki |
投稿者 | : BAL |
URL | : http://f43.aaa.livedoor.jp/~sumure/ |
> 以前よりカート便利に使用させて頂いております。
>
> 送料について以下のような場合どのように変更したらよいのでしょうか。
>
> お買上金額が
> 5,250円以上送料無料(その他の地域)
> 北海道10,500円以上送料無料
> 沖縄21,000円以上送料無料
> それ未満の時は、地域送料が計上されるというものです
>
> 可能であればご教授頂けますようお願い致します。
以下の追加修正を。
●mart_init.cgi
#-------------------------------------------------
# 買物カゴ中身
#-------------------------------------------------
-- 省略 --
# 最終確認画面
if ($job eq "view") {
# 送料サービスフラグ
local($serv_flag)=0;
# 県別送料
if ($postage > 0) {
local($memo);
#▼ここから▼
if($in{'pref2'}) {$in{'pref'} = $in{'pref2'};}
if($in{'pref'}==0) {$cari_serv = 10500;}
if($in{'pref'}==46) {$cari_serv = 21000;}
#▲ここまで追加▲
# 送料サービス有り
●mart_order.cgi
#-------------------------------------------------
# 注文送信 (Step3)
#-------------------------------------------------
-- 省略 --
# 送料サービスフラグ
local($serv_flag)=0;
# 県別送料
if ($postage > 0) {
local($memo);
#▼ここから▼
if($in{'pref2'}) {$in{'pref'} = $in{'pref2'};}
if($in{'pref'}==0) {$cari_serv = 10500;}
if($in{'pref'}==46) {$cari_serv = 21000;}
#▲ここまで追加▲
# 送料サービス有り
記事No | : 8083 |
投稿日 | : 2010/10/28(Thu) 22:06:10 |
タイトル | : Re^2: WEB MART 送料を地域別、金額別で無料にするには? |
ID情報 | : 3758 |
投稿者 | : 73 |
URL | : http://benifu-ki.com |
BALさん
早速、お返事頂きまして有難うございました。
感激です只今、テストしてみました完璧です。
他のページを修正してから変更したいと思います。
本当に有難うございました。
感謝m(_ _)m
> 以下の追加修正を。
>
> ●mart_init.cgi
>
> #-------------------------------------------------
> # 買物カゴ中身
> #-------------------------------------------------
> -- 省略 --
>
> # 最終確認画面
> if ($job eq "view") {
>
> # 送料サービスフラグ
> local($serv_flag)=0;
>
> # 県別送料
> if ($postage > 0) {
> local($memo);
> #▼ここから▼
> if($in{'pref2'}) {$in{'pref'} = $in{'pref2'};}
> if($in{'pref'}==0) {$cari_serv = 10500;}
> if($in{'pref'}==46) {$cari_serv = 21000;}
> #▲ここまで追加▲
> # 送料サービス有り
>
>
> ●mart_order.cgi
>
> #-------------------------------------------------
> # 注文送信 (Step3)
> #-------------------------------------------------
> -- 省略 --
>
> # 送料サービスフラグ
> local($serv_flag)=0;
>
> # 県別送料
> if ($postage > 0) {
> local($memo);
> #▼ここから▼
> if($in{'pref2'}) {$in{'pref'} = $in{'pref2'};}
> if($in{'pref'}==0) {$cari_serv = 10500;}
> if($in{'pref'}==46) {$cari_serv = 21000;}
> #▲ここまで追加▲
> # 送料サービス有り
記事No | : 8697 |
投稿日 | : 2011/07/02(Sat) 11:35:17 |
タイトル | : Re^2: BALさんこちらもお願いします |
ID情報 | : 3758 |
投稿者 | : 73 |
URL | : http://dimaven.com |
BALさん
以前に教えていただきましたこちらの送料の件
現行<Ver:2.13>で同じ事をする場合は
どのようにしたら良いのでしょうか?
いろいろとすみませんが宜しくお願い致します
m(__)m
> > 以前よりカート便利に使用させて頂いております。
> >
> > 送料について以下のような場合どのように変更したらよいのでしょうか。
> >
> > お買上金額が
> > 5,250円以上送料無料(その他の地域)
> > 北海道10,500円以上送料無料
> > 沖縄21,000円以上送料無料
> > それ未満の時は、地域送料が計上されるというものです
> >
> > 可能であればご教授頂けますようお願い致します。
>
>
> 以下の追加修正を。
>
> ●mart_init.cgi
>
> #-------------------------------------------------
> # 買物カゴ中身
> #-------------------------------------------------
> -- 省略 --
>
> # 最終確認画面
> if ($job eq "view") {
>
> # 送料サービスフラグ
> local($serv_flag)=0;
>
> # 県別送料
> if ($postage > 0) {
> local($memo);
> #▼ここから▼
> if($in{'pref2'}) {$in{'pref'} = $in{'pref2'};}
> if($in{'pref'}==0) {$cari_serv = 10500;}
> if($in{'pref'}==46) {$cari_serv = 21000;}
> #▲ここまで追加▲
> # 送料サービス有り
>
>
> ●mart_order.cgi
>
> #-------------------------------------------------
> # 注文送信 (Step3)
> #-------------------------------------------------
> -- 省略 --
>
> # 送料サービスフラグ
> local($serv_flag)=0;
>
> # 県別送料
> if ($postage > 0) {
> local($memo);
> #▼ここから▼
> if($in{'pref2'}) {$in{'pref'} = $in{'pref2'};}
> if($in{'pref'}==0) {$cari_serv = 10500;}
> if($in{'pref'}==46) {$cari_serv = 21000;}
> #▲ここまで追加▲
> # 送料サービス有り
記事No | : 8706 |
投稿日 | : 2011/07/02(Sat) 20:34:44 |
タイトル | : Re^3: BALさんこちらもお願いします |
ID情報 | : Fuyuki |
投稿者 | : BAL |
URL | : http://f43.aaa.livedoor.jp/~sumure/ |
> BALさん
>
> 以前に教えていただきましたこちらの送料の件
>
> 現行<Ver:2.13>で同じ事をする場合は
> どのようにしたら良いのでしょうか?
これでいいと思います。
#-----------------------------------------------------------
# 確認画面 (Step2)
#-----------------------------------------------------------
-- 省略 --
# 送料
if ($postage > 0) {
##-------------------------------------------
if($q->param('pref2') ne "") {$q{pref} = $q{pref2};}
if($q{pref}==0) {$cf{cari_serv} = 10500;}
if($q{pref}==46) {$cf{cari_serv} = 21000;}
##-------------------------------------------
# 送料サービス有り
if ($cf{cari_serv} && $cf{cari_serv} <= $all) {
$postage = 0;
$serv_flag++;
}
#-----------------------------------------------------------
# 注文送信 (Step3)
#-----------------------------------------------------------
-- 省略 --
# 県別送料
my $memo;
if ($postage > 0) {
##------------------------------------------------
if($q->param('pref2') ne "") {$q{pref} = $q{pref2};}
if($q{pref}==0) {$cf{cari_serv} = 10500;}
if($q{pref}==46) {$cf{cari_serv} = 21000;}
##------------------------------------------------
# 送料サービス有り
$q{postage} = 0;
if ($cf{cari_serv} && $cf{cari_serv } <= $all) {
$q{postage} = $postage = 0;
$q{postage} .= ' (送料サービス)';
記事No | : 8714 |
投稿日 | : 2011/07/04(Mon) 12:41:40 |
タイトル | : Re^4: BALさんこちらもお願いします |
ID情報 | : 3758 |
投稿者 | : 73 |
URL | : http://dimaven.com |
BALさん
ありがとうございました
Web Mart<Ver:2.15>でテストしてみました
問題はありませんでした。
感謝致しております。
本当にありがとうございました。
> > BALさん
> >
> > 以前に教えていただきましたこちらの送料の件
> >
> > 現行<Ver:2.13>で同じ事をする場合は
> > どのようにしたら良いのでしょうか?
>
> これでいいと思います。
>
> #-----------------------------------------------------------
> # 確認画面 (Step2)
> #-----------------------------------------------------------
>
> -- 省略 --
> # 送料
> if ($postage > 0) {
> ##-------------------------------------------
> if($q->param('pref2') ne "") {$q{pref} = $q{pref2};}
> if($q{pref}==0) {$cf{cari_serv} = 10500;}
> if($q{pref}==46) {$cf{cari_serv} = 21000;}
> ##-------------------------------------------
> # 送料サービス有り
> if ($cf{cari_serv} && $cf{cari_serv} <= $all) {
> $postage = 0;
> $serv_flag++;
> }
>
>
> #-----------------------------------------------------------
> # 注文送信 (Step3)
> #-----------------------------------------------------------
>
> -- 省略 --
>
> # 県別送料
> my $memo;
> if ($postage > 0) {
> ##------------------------------------------------
> if($q->param('pref2') ne "") {$q{pref} = $q{pref2};}
> if($q{pref}==0) {$cf{cari_serv} = 10500;}
> if($q{pref}==46) {$cf{cari_serv} = 21000;}
> ##------------------------------------------------
> # 送料サービス有り
> $q{postage} = 0;
> if ($cf{cari_serv} && $cf{cari_serv } <= $all) {
> $q{postage} = $postage = 0;
> $q{postage} .= ' (送料サービス)';
記事No | : 8990 |
投稿日 | : 2011/08/23(Tue) 12:56:27 |
タイトル | : Re^4: BALさんよろしくお願いします |
ID情報 | : 3758 |
投稿者 | : 73 |
URL | : http://dimaven.com |
BALさん
いつも大変お世話になっています。
少し前に教えていただきました件なのですが
以下の通り設定しましたところ「確認画面」では、完全にOKなのですが
テストが不十分だったようです
「送信文」のところで違う結果が発生しておりました。
基本 init.cgiにて 5250円以上送料無料に設定しております
指定しました(北海道)は、OKでしたが
その他の地域の場合、5250円以上の時に、送料が加算されてしまいます
沖縄につきましては、10500円以上で、送料無料になってしまいます。
北海道の指定が優先されているようです
●名前の後ろに“テスト”と入れて頂ければテストは OKです。
よろしくお願い致します。
>
> #-----------------------------------------------------------
> # 確認画面 (Step2)
> #-----------------------------------------------------------
>
> -- 省略 --
> # 送料
> if ($postage > 0) {
> ##-------------------------------------------
> if($q->param('pref2') ne "") {$q{pref} = $q{pref2};}
> if($q{pref}==0) {$cf{cari_serv} = 10500;}
> if($q{pref}==46) {$cf{cari_serv} = 21000;}
> ##-------------------------------------------
> # 送料サービス有り
> if ($cf{cari_serv} && $cf{cari_serv} <= $all) {
> $postage = 0;
> $serv_flag++;
> }
>
>
> #-----------------------------------------------------------
> # 注文送信 (Step3)
> #-----------------------------------------------------------
>
> -- 省略 --
>
> # 県別送料
> my $memo;
> if ($postage > 0) {
> ##------------------------------------------------
> if($q->param('pref2') ne "") {$q{pref} = $q{pref2};}
> if($q{pref}==0) {$cf{cari_serv} = 10500;}
> if($q{pref}==46) {$cf{cari_serv} = 21000;}
> ##------------------------------------------------
> # 送料サービス有り
> $q{postage} = 0;
> if ($cf{cari_serv} && $cf{cari_serv } <= $all) {
> $q{postage} = $postage = 0;
> $q{postage} .= ' (送料サービス)';
記事No | : 8992 |
投稿日 | : 2011/08/23(Tue) 21:12:52 |
タイトル | : Re^5: BALさんよろしくお願いします |
ID情報 | : Fuyuki |
投稿者 | : BAL |
URL | : http://f43.aaa.livedoor.jp/~sumure/ |
これは申し訳ない、以下に変更してください。
#-----------------------------------------------------------
# 注文送信 (Step3)
#-----------------------------------------------------------
if($q{pref} eq "北海道") {$cf{cari_serv} = 10500;}
if($q{pref} eq "沖縄") {$cf{cari_serv} = 21000;}
記事No | : 8993 |
投稿日 | : 2011/08/24(Wed) 12:35:25 |
タイトル | : Re^6: BALさんよろしくお願いします |
ID情報 | : 3758 |
投稿者 | : 73 |
URL | : http://dimaven.com |
修正しました。
何時も助けて頂いて感謝しております。
ありがとうございました。
> これは申し訳ない、以下に変更してください。
>
> #-----------------------------------------------------------
> # 注文送信 (Step3)
> #-----------------------------------------------------------
>
>
> if($q{pref} eq "北海道") {$cf{cari_serv} = 10500;}
> if($q{pref} eq "沖縄県") {$cf{cari_serv} = 21000;}